Definition: Unformatted Capacity


The total number of usable bytes on a disk, including the space that is required to record location, boundary definitions, and servo data. (See also formatted capacity.)

Soft Sectored

A technique that allows the controller to determine the beginning of a sector by reading the format information from the disk.
